Uses of Class
de.xima.fc.interfaces.workflow.value.ValueDescriptorNode
Packages that use ValueDescriptorNode
-
Uses of ValueDescriptorNode in de.xima.fc.interfaces.workflow.value
Subclasses of ValueDescriptorNode in de.xima.fc.interfaces.workflow.valueModifier and TypeClassDescriptionstatic final classNode representing the list item value descriptor of a list value descriptor.static final classNode representing the map value descriptor of a map value descriptor.static final classNode representing a record member at a certain key in a record value descriptor.static final classValueDescriptorNode.Root<Value, Builder extends IValueBuilder<Value>>Node representing the root of the value descriptor tree.static final classNode representing a tuple element at a certain index in a tuple value descriptor.static final classClasses in de.xima.fc.interfaces.workflow.value that implement interfaces with type arguments of type ValueDescriptorNodeModifier and TypeClassDescriptionenumAITreeAccessorforValueDescriptorNode.classImplementsTreeVisit.ITreeVisitorforValueDescriptorNodeand adds specific methods for each subtype of value descriptor node.Methods in de.xima.fc.interfaces.workflow.value that return types with arguments of type ValueDescriptorNodeModifier and TypeMethodDescriptionIterable<? extends ValueDescriptorNode<?, ?>> TreeAccessorValueDescriptorNode.getChildren(ValueDescriptorNode<?, ?> node) abstract Iterable<? extends ValueDescriptorNode<?, ?>> ValueDescriptorNode.getChildren()Gets the children of this node in the tree structure.Iterable<? extends ValueDescriptorNode<?, ?>> ValueDescriptorNode.ListItem.getChildren()Iterable<? extends ValueDescriptorNode<?, ?>> ValueDescriptorNode.MapValue.getChildren()Iterable<? extends ValueDescriptorNode<?, ?>> ValueDescriptorNode.RecordKey.getChildren()Iterable<? extends ValueDescriptorNode<?, ?>> ValueDescriptorNode.Root.getChildren()Iterable<? extends ValueDescriptorNode<?, ?>> ValueDescriptorNode.TupleIndex.getChildren()Iterable<? extends ValueDescriptorNode<?, ?>> ValueDescriptorNode.UnionMember.getChildren()Methods in de.xima.fc.interfaces.workflow.value with parameters of type ValueDescriptorNodeModifier and TypeMethodDescriptionprotected voidValueDescriptorNodeVisitor.afterEnter(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path, TreeVisit.ETreeVisitResult result) Called after entering any node.protected voidValueDescriptorNodeVisitor.afterExit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path, boolean result) Called after exiting any node.protected voidValueDescriptorNodeVisitor.afterVisit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path, boolean result) Called after visiting any node.protected voidValueDescriptorNodeVisitor.beforeEnter(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Called before entering any node.protected voidValueDescriptorNodeVisitor.beforeExit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Called before exiting any node.protected voidValueDescriptorNodeVisitor.beforeVisit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Called before visiting any node.ValueDescriptorNodeVisitor.enter(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) final booleanValueDescriptorNodeVisitor.exit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Iterable<? extends ValueDescriptorNode<?, ?>> TreeAccessorValueDescriptorNode.getChildren(ValueDescriptorNode<?, ?> node) TreeAccessorValueDescriptorNode.getId(ValueDescriptorNode<?, ?> node) final booleanValueDescriptorNodeVisitor.visit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Method parameters in de.xima.fc.interfaces.workflow.value with type arguments of type ValueDescriptorNodeModifier and TypeMethodDescriptionprotected voidValueDescriptorNodeVisitor.afterEnter(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path, TreeVisit.ETreeVisitResult result) Called after entering any node.protected voidValueDescriptorNodeVisitor.afterExit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path, boolean result) Called after exiting any node.protected voidValueDescriptorNodeVisitor.afterVisit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path, boolean result) Called after visiting any node.protected voidValueDescriptorNodeVisitor.beforeEnter(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Called before entering any node.protected voidValueDescriptorNodeVisitor.beforeExit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Called before exiting any node.protected voidValueDescriptorNodeVisitor.beforeVisit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Called before visiting any node.ValueDescriptorNodeVisitor.enter(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) protected TreeVisit.ETreeVisitResultValueDescriptorNodeVisitor.enterListItem(ValueDescriptorNode.ListItem<?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Enters aValueDescriptorNode.ListItemnode.protected TreeVisit.ETreeVisitResultValueDescriptorNodeVisitor.enterMapValue(ValueDescriptorNode.MapValue<?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Enters aValueDescriptorNode.MapValuenode.protected TreeVisit.ETreeVisitResultValueDescriptorNodeVisitor.enterRecordKey(ValueDescriptorNode.RecordKey node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Enters aValueDescriptorNode.RecordKeynode.protected TreeVisit.ETreeVisitResultValueDescriptorNodeVisitor.enterRoot(ValueDescriptorNode.Root<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Enters aValueDescriptorNode.Rootnode.protected TreeVisit.ETreeVisitResultValueDescriptorNodeVisitor.enterTupleIndex(ValueDescriptorNode.TupleIndex node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Enters aValueDescriptorNode.TupleIndexnode.protected TreeVisit.ETreeVisitResultValueDescriptorNodeVisitor.enterUnionMember(ValueDescriptorNode.UnionMember node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Enters aValueDescriptorNode.UnionMembernode.final booleanValueDescriptorNodeVisitor.exit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) protected booleanValueDescriptorNodeVisitor.exitListItem(ValueDescriptorNode.ListItem<?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Exits aValueDescriptorNode.ListItemnode.protected booleanValueDescriptorNodeVisitor.exitMapValue(ValueDescriptorNode.MapValue<?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Exits aValueDescriptorNode.MapValuenode.protected booleanValueDescriptorNodeVisitor.exitRecordKey(ValueDescriptorNode.RecordKey node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Exits aValueDescriptorNode.RecordKeynode.protected booleanValueDescriptorNodeVisitor.exitRoot(ValueDescriptorNode.Root<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Exits aValueDescriptorNode.Rootnode.protected booleanValueDescriptorNodeVisitor.exitTupleIndex(ValueDescriptorNode.TupleIndex node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Exits aValueDescriptorNode.TupleIndexnode.protected booleanValueDescriptorNodeVisitor.exitUnionMember(ValueDescriptorNode.UnionMember node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Exits aValueDescriptorNode.UnionMembernode.final booleanValueDescriptorNodeVisitor.visit(ValueDescriptorNode<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) protected booleanValueDescriptorNodeVisitor.visitListItem(ValueDescriptorNode.ListItem<?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Visits aValueDescriptorNode.ListItemnode.protected booleanValueDescriptorNodeVisitor.visitMapValue(ValueDescriptorNode.MapValue<?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Visits aValueDescriptorNode.MapValuenode.protected booleanValueDescriptorNodeVisitor.visitRecordKey(ValueDescriptorNode.RecordKey node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Visits aValueDescriptorNode.RecordKeynode.protected booleanValueDescriptorNodeVisitor.visitRoot(ValueDescriptorNode.Root<?, ?> node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Visits aValueDescriptorNode.Rootnode.protected booleanValueDescriptorNodeVisitor.visitTupleIndex(ValueDescriptorNode.TupleIndex node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Visits aValueDescriptorNode.TupleIndexnode.protected booleanValueDescriptorNodeVisitor.visitUnionMember(ValueDescriptorNode.UnionMember node, List<TreeVisit.TreePathFragment<ValueDescriptorNode<?, ?>>> path) Visits aValueDescriptorNode.UnionMembernode.